
來源:四川成都網站建設公司
日期:2017-07-28
瀏覽:18
很多站長使用虛擬主機來做網站,網頁內容一旦很多,網站打開速度就會特別慢,如果說服務器、帶寬、CDN這類硬指標我們沒有經濟實力去做,不妨通過網頁代碼優化的方式來提高速度,總結了一些可行性的方法。
1: 縮小Javascript和CSS文件
如果你的網站大約有50-60%的用戶是第一次訪客,那么這些人會下載Javascript和CSS,如果這些文件很大瀏覽器會下載很長時間。
使用壓縮工具可以減少Javascript和CSS盡一半的文件大小。
2:減少HTTP請求
瀏覽器會花費80%的時間獲取外部元件,包括腳本、樣式表、圖像等,只有20%的時間用來加載內容,每個網站都會有許多HTTP請求,由于只有2個HTTP請求可以在同一時間傳送,所以請求一旦過多就會造成延遲。
3:緩存圖片、CSS和Javascript
每當一個新用戶訪問你的網站,圖片、CSS和Javascript應該在其瀏覽器緩存,這樣他們下一次訪問就特別快。
絕大多數windows主機已經默認啟用了,只需要在控制面板中設定過期時間和文件類型那個就可以了,我建議圖片、CSS和Javascript時間可設置為一個月。
4:合并CSS引用圖片
如果我們把CSS圖片合并成一個,14個HTTP請求變成1個,想想會是什么效果?它的原理就是通過CSS坐標的方式取得圖片徑路,每個CSS標簽引用不同坐標就會得到不同圖片。我們看到很多網站的CSS圖片只有一張,用的就是這個原理。
5:只加載部分的基本腳本
這個最簡單,不花時間,點擊自己網站右鍵“查看源文件”找到與之間的區域,看看那些不重要好的JS文件,把它仍到頁面底部,也就是讓它最后加載。或者直接刪除。
6:對圖像進行壓縮
除非你加載視頻,那么影響網站速度罪魁禍首應該就是圖片了,如果是jpeg、png圖片,保證不失品質的前提下,讓他們盡量壓縮,Fireworks軟件“導出向導”功能,它提供了一個很好的方式來預覽保存的圖像,讓圖片大小與質量之間平衡,大多數其他圖像編輯軟件都有類似的功能。
7:開啟gzip模塊
gzip壓縮是非常流行的一種數據壓縮格式,一般網站啟用gzip后,壓縮率都會有70%-80%的提升,效果是立竿見影的。
部分虛擬主機默認有gzip功能,但大部分沒有,獨立主機、VPS一般可以設置,開啟gzip會加重服務器負擔,而且要修改服務器配置,強烈建議大家開啟gzip,如果不清楚可以問問所在空間商,讓他們幫忙開啟。
成都網站建設公司(http://www.yyqnl.com/)為企業提供一站式網站服務及網絡營銷服務。服務項目涵蓋:高端網站建設、企業網站建設、網頁設計、網站制作、成都建網站、成都網站制作、成都網站優化、電子商城網站建設、品牌網站設計及網頁制作;成都微店制作,成都微站制作,成都微信網站制作,微店鋪制作,微商城,微信營銷,app制作,手機app制作,APP制作開發等。
成都建網站就找專業網站建設公司——四川明騰信息技術有限公司,全國免費咨詢熱線:400-8081601
文章由四川明騰網絡成都網站建設編輯整理,轉載請注明出處
|響應式建站 | 政府事業建站 |集團公司建站 |醫院建站 |企業建站 |B2B商城 |B2C商城 |門戶類建站 |OA系統